Log into your profile at www.badgecert.com.
From the My Badge Portfolio view (see image below), you can easily share badges in the “Public Group” with the unique code found in the upper right corner. By default, this group will be empty. Copy the URL for your unique code. Save this URL for later use.
If you click on the unique code link when the “Public” group has no badges, you will see a message: “No badges in public profile OR all the badges have expired.” You will need to drag and drop badges to this “Public” group to see the badges from your unique code. You will need to drag and drop badges to this Public Group. This is a good option for sharing badges on an email signature or resume as you can manage it or update it from your portfolio at any time. You can also email this group to someone by clicking the envelope icon.
Log into your account at www.scrumalliance.org and visit your dashboard. While on your dashboard (see image below), click the "View Certification Details" button. Here, you will have the opportunity to download an image of your certification.
Once you have both the image and the URL for your unique code saved, you are ready to add your badge to your personal site. There should be an ability to upload artwork/images. Upload the digital badge you just saved to your computer. Thereafter, you can add the URL profile link originally provided by clicking on the image and using the "hyperlink" functionality for your website editor. Please note: The badge image embed in an email will be static -> they are just images The URL must be added as a hyperlink to make it clickable for the badge information/metadata.
